Questions, answered.
- What is Allegro MicroSystems, Inc.'s intangibles (net)?
- Allegro MicroSystems, Inc. (ALGM) reported intangibles (net) of $238.68M in Q1 2026.
- How has Allegro MicroSystems, Inc.'s intangibles (net) changed year-over-year?
- Allegro MicroSystems, Inc.'s intangibles (net) decreased by 8.9% year-over-year, from $262.12M to $238.68M.
- What is the long-term trend for Allegro MicroSystems, Inc.'s intangibles (net)?
- Over 5 years (2021 to 2026), Allegro MicroSystems, Inc.'s intangibles (net) has grown at a 45.7%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$36.37M to $238.68M.
- What does intangibles (net) mean?
- The value of non-physical assets like patents and brands, adjusted for wear and tear.
- How do you interpret intangibles (net)?
- A steady decline is expected due to amortization, while sudden increases indicate new acquisitions or intellectual property investments.
- How does intangibles (net) compare across companies?
- High in technology and semiconductor firms due to the importance of patent portfolios.
